ABOUT HOMEWAV
Founded in 2011, HomeWAV LLC has been the leader in providing safe, secure inmate communication and technology solutions to correctional facilities across the country. Headquartered in St. Louis, MO, our cutting-edge technology connects incarcerated individuals to the essential people in their lives through secure messaging platforms, allowing facilities to maintain a safe and stable environment while allowing families to connect. We have seen firsthand how our innovative platform supports no-contact communication while effectively reducing recidivism and improving inmates' overall health. We've supported correctional facilities and inmates in over 30 states – in the process, we have connected millions of visitors with their incarcerated loved ones.
POSITION SUMMARY
HomeWAV is searching for a motivated, goal-oriented Field Service Technician (FST) to join our growing team. The FST's primary duties are to service, maintain, troubleshoot, and repair inmate communication systems at the customer"s premises — all while following and meeting all internal processes, procedures, and contractual timelines.
This position will be stationed within one of our customers' facilities working remotely with our home office. Our ideal candidate will possess an aptitude for problem solving, be able to work independently without direct supervision, exhibit great customer relations and communications skills, and thrive in an ever changing, trailblazing company atmosphere.

PHYSICAL DEMANDS, REQUIREMENTS & WORK ENVIRONMENT
This position will be stationed in a correctional facility and will require work inside inmate housing units.
- Ability to lift or move up to 50lbs.
- Ability to spend long periods of the day standing.
- Ability to spend long periods of the day sitting.
- Must be able to use hand tools.
- Must pass background checks.
- Must have a driver's license.
- Occasional travel to other facilities may be necessary.
